Benghazi Whistleblower: The Stand Down & Cover Up

First published at 12:31 UTC on March 18th, 2019.
subscribers

In this Special Release of Operation Freedom Briefings, Charles Woods & Travis, a Benghazi Whistleblower, blow open the truth of the stand down & cover up.

Additional information & content is available at: davejanda.com

CategoryNews & Politics
SensitivityNormal - Content that is suitable for ages 16 and over
DISCUSS THIS VIDEO